Overview of CPT Code 20957: Injection of sacroiliac joint, fluoroscopic guidance

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is a sacroiliac joint injection?

It is an injection of medication into the sacroiliac joint to relieve pain.

How long does the procedure take?

The injection typically takes about 30 minutes.

Will I feel pain during the injection?

You may feel some discomfort, but local anesthesia is used to minimize pain.

How soon can I return to normal activities?

Most patients can resume normal activities within a day or two.

What should I do if I experience side effects?

Contact your healthcare provider if you notice any unusual symptoms.
